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
438 4736842091 25785313 39771348 8025229229
511001 87013758
511001 87013758
72526284 013 92442665 7613027840 88
All about undefined
Interested in learning more?
511001 87013758
72526284 013 92442665 7613027840 88
See more
6386561 380
31 9362072 60682379274
See more
69 79720836186
410 90 23 665
See more